Man convicted for being in possession of firearm

Dec 11, 2013, 9:34 AM | Article By: Halimatou Ceesay

One Gibril Bojang, a prescription for the cattle at Kanilai Family Farm, was Monday convicted by the Brikama Magistrates’ Court, presided over by Magistrate S.K. Jorbateh.

Bojang was convicted on a charge of being in possession of firearm without authority.

Delivering her judgement, the trial magistrate said she understood the convict was a first-time offender, a family man and a sole breadwinner.

She said the convict was remorseful throughout the trial and if given the chance, he would change.

However, she said, the convict was charged with a serious crime of being in possession of firearm without authority, which poses a threat to the security of the state.

She therefore sentenced him to pay a fine of D100, 000 in default to serve 5 years in jail.

The court ordered that the single barrel gun be forfeited to the state.

The charge sheet stated that the accused, Gibril Bojang, on 13 October 2013, at Kanilai, Foni Kansala, was found in possession of a single barrel gun without a licence from the Inspector General of Police, and thereby committed an offence.
